Here are the team of Pokémon in this video, which was decided by the random number generator.
P1 Team: Sandslash, Electrode, Hitmonlee, Zubat, Ditto, Pikachu
CPU Team: Bulbasaur, Starmie, Rapidash, Jolteon, Pidgeot, Machoke

Then, I will list the moves for each Pokémon in battle, starting with my team.
Sandslash: Dig, Swift, Seismic Toss, Sand-Attack
Electrode: Thunder, Thunder Wave, Swift, Selfdestruct
Hitmonlee: Hi Jump Kick, Mega Kick, Metronome, Seismic Toss
Zubat: Confuse Ray, Mega Drain, Toxic, Double-Edge
Ditto: Transform
Pikachu: Thunderbolt, Slam, Thunder Wave, Seismic Toss

The CPU's team of Pokémon and moves.
Bulbasaur: Leech Seed, Toxic, Body Slam, Razor Leaf
Starmie: Surf, Thunder, Swift, Harden
Rapidash: Fire Blast, Stomp, Toxic, Fire Spin
Jolteon: Thunderbolt, Pin Missile, Toxic, Sand-Attack
Pidgeot: Mirror Move, Fly, Quick Attack, Sand-Attack
Machoke: Submission, Strength, Rock Slide, Focus Energy

The teams we both use have Pokémon of many different types, I have two Electric-type Pokémon, both have Thunder Wave, while the CPU has Pokémon that all have different types, none of them have the same type throughout the team.
We both led with Fighting-type Pokémon, I had Hitmonlee, and the CPU used Machoke, it was a good thing that I led with Hitmonlee, because the rest of the CPU team have Special moves, and Hitmonlee has a very low Special stat, Pidgeot is the only one that does not have a Special Attack, but it has the type advantage due to it being a Flying-type Pokémon.
Whenever I have a Thunder Wave user, like Electrode, I try and save it for when I need to use it, as Electrode is the fastest Pokémon in the game, and against Pokémon like Rapidash, Starmie, and Jolteon which have a high Speed stat, that is where paralysis comes in, Pikachu does have Thunder Wave, but it cannot take hits that well compared to Electrode.
There are some Pokémon that I like to try and save for a Pokémon that they have the best chance against, the best example is Zubat, where its only good matchup is against Bulbasaur, and it resists moves that the rest of my Pokémon have, and while I have Sandslash as an option for Jolteon, I usually try and give the other Pokémon a chance to take part in the battle and find ways to make them work instead of relying that much on type advantages.
